Publisher's Synopsis
"Malcolm Miller was a poet who spent much of his life in Salem, Massachusetts. After publishing two collections of his work with a traditional publisher in Canada, he self-published many small collections in the years that followed. After his death in 2014, some admirers of his poetry, including Rod Kessler, who taught creative writing at Salem State University for many years, gathered some of his finest poems together, which are presented in this book. An introduction by Rod Kessler is included in this collection. Miller's work is evidence of an original and authentic American voice"--.
